程序网格是指由计算机程序生成的三维网格模型。ThreeJS是一个用于创建和展示3D图形的JavaScript库。在ThreeJS中,程序网格的一部分不可见可能是由于以下几种情况:
- 隐藏:在ThreeJS中,可以通过设置网格对象的visible属性为false来隐藏网格的某些部分。这样,这部分网格将不会在渲染过程中显示出来。
- 材质设置:网格的可见性也可能受到其所应用的材质的影响。如果网格的材质设置为透明或半透明,那么部分网格可能会因为透明度的原因而不可见。
- 剔除:在渲染过程中,为了提高性能,ThreeJS可能会对不可见的网格进行剔除,即不对其进行渲染。这种剔除可以通过设置网格对象的frustumCulled属性为true来实现。
- 错误或缺失:另一种可能是程序网格的一部分在创建或加载过程中出现了错误或缺失。这可能是由于程序逻辑错误、数据加载错误或模型文件损坏等原因导致的。
对于程序网格的不可见部分,可以通过调试和检查代码来确定具体原因,并进行相应的修复。在ThreeJS中,可以使用调试工具、查看网格的属性和材质设置,以及检查加载过程中的错误信息来帮助解决这个问题。
腾讯云相关产品和产品介绍链接地址:
- 腾讯云ThreeJS云函数:https://cloud.tencent.com/product/scf
- 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
- 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
- 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
- 腾讯云物联网(IoT):https://cloud.tencent.com/product/iot
- 腾讯云移动开发(移动推送、移动分析等):https://cloud.tencent.com/product/mobile